About this spot
CASA DE AZUL offers a sophisticated dining experience in Umeda where the menu highlights include rich Spanish tapas and grilled meats that feel distinctly different from standard Osaka fare. The restaurant's modern interior provides a perfect backdrop for travelers looking to escape the typical ramen or katsu culture of the city.

Common Questions
How much does CASA DE AZUL cost?
Prices range from 3,000 to 6,000 JPY per person (approx. $20–$40 USD), depending on whether you choose a set menu or à la carte tapas.
Where is CASA DE AZUL?
Located in the Umeda & Kita neighborhood of Osaka, near the JR Osaka Station and Umeda Sky Building area.
What should I order if I don't eat pork?
You can safely enjoy their seafood paella, grilled prawns, and various vegetable-based tapas which are staples on the menu.
